Motion Simulation Market Overview and Report Coverage

Motion simulation is a technology that uses computer software and hardware to replicate the movement and dynamics of real-world objects in a virtual environment. It is widely used in various industries such as automotive, aerospace, and entertainment for training, testing, and research purposes.

Market Segmentation

The Motion Simulation Market Analysis by Types is segmented into:

Motion simulation market typically has two main types: hydraulic-based and actuator-based. Hydraulic-based simulators use fluid power to generate motion, providing a realistic experience in driving or flight simulations. On the other hand, actuator-based simulators use electric motors or pneumatic systems to create motion. Both types of simulators are commonly used in training, entertainment, and research applications to recreate realistic movements and improve overall user experience. Motion simulation is widely used in various industries such as aerospace and defense, automotive, electrical and electronics, and industrial machinery. In the aerospace and defense sector, motion simulation is essential for flight simulators and pilot training. In the automotive industry, it is used for testing vehicles and driver training. Motion simulation is also utilized in testing electronic devices and equipment in the electrical and electronics industry. In the industrial machinery market, it is crucial for optimizing machine performance and operator training.
